BTU (BTU)
BTU is used in heat engineering, air conditioning, heating, and English-language engineering tables.
History: BTU began in British heat engineering as the heat required to warm a pound of water by one degree Fahrenheit.

Example: 1 BTU = 0.0002930711 kWh. Conversion formula: result = value × 1055.05585262 / 3600000.

The kilowatt-hour is the main household electricity unit on bills and appliances.
History: the kilowatt-hour became the standard electricity-billing unit for household and industrial energy.
